Cloud + AI (C+AI) is an exciting business that is helping to drive innovation and leadership with our customers and at Microsoft. The executive office of the EVP is looking to fill a key role on its business management team. This role will help support the team's customer and partner engagement and business operations. As a business manager in the C+AI executive office, you will play a critical role in supporting customer and partner engagement, coordinating business operations for our rhythm of the business (ROB), C+AI All-Hands and other events. Working closely with the chief of staff, you will create and implement operational processes and practices that drive efficiencies for the C+AI executive vice president, leadership team and organization. This role is an extension of the leadership team and you will be a key factor in our success.

Operations: Drive and continuously improve the overall C+AI rhythm of the business (ROB). Operations: Lead logistics, planning and execution of C+AI team events, e.g. Ask Me Anything, All-Hands, offsites, partner meetings. Strategy: Assist in strategy and management of business planning and diversity initiatives. Integration: Assist with integration efforts of acquired companies both in pre- and post-closed work groups lead by C+AI. Productivity: Develop and create business processes and tools to continuously improve organizational efficiency Additional special projects as needed
Required Qualifications: A minimum of 5 years of experience in business management, global project, or operations management Bachelor's degree business, finance, engineering, operations or equivalent experience (MBA preferred).
